GOLDEN RAMS STUNNED BY NORTH GREENVILLE 35-27

September 16, 2017

ALBANY, GA- North Greenville University handed the #16 ranked Albany State University Golden Rams their first loss of the year with a 35-27 victory Saturday night at ASU Coliseum.

With Saturday night's result both teams find themselves at 2-1 overall on the young season.

The Crusaders did most of their damage  on the ground, rolling up 266 yards behind two 100-yard rushers. Ashton Heard had 17 carries for 134 yards and a 31 yard rushing touchdown while teammate Tracy Scott found the end zone twice with TDs from 25 and 31 yards out. Scott finished the night with 119 yards rushing at 9.9 yards per carry.

The Crusaders ran 20 fewer plays (56) than the Golden Rams for 378 yards of total offense to 503 yards of offense for the home team. NGU was 3-3 in red zone chances and made their way into the end zone in each quarter of play.

ASU took the game's opening drive 11 plays, 69 yards and Gabriel Ballinas hit a field goal from 25 yards out for an early 3-0 advantage. However their (only) lead was short lived when NGU took the ensuing possession 55 yards in just 5 plays and with Scott's first TD, the visitors jumped in front 7-3. Matt Gravely capped a 9-play, 57 yard drive with a 19 yard field goal with 7 seconds left in the opening quarter for a 10-3 advantage.

The game's biggest momentum swing came when the Crusaders capitalized on a muffed ASU punt and recovered the ball at the Golden Rams' 33 yard line. Two plays, later Scott danced back into the end zone for another score and symbolic of ASU's luck on Saturday, the blocked extra point attempt was scooped up by Jordan Helms. Helms powered his way across the goal line for a two-point conversion and an 18-6 Crusader lead.

North Greenville added a touchdown and a field goal in the third quarter to negate the Golden Rams' first touchdown of the game, an 8-yard running score by Chancellor Johnson.

At the start of the fourth, ASU trailed 28-13 until a 6 yard TD run by McKinley Habersham; the extra point was blocked along with any momentum the Golden Rams had hoped to build when NGU QB Will Hunter connected on his first passing score, a 7-yard touchdown to Demajiay Rooks with 9:08 to go.

Albany State added touchdown reception by Chris Sparks with 1:07 left for the final point spread.

The Golden Rams will hit the road for two straight weeks starting with the University of West Georgia on Saturday, September 23rd in Carrollton, GA. Game time is scheduled for 2pm.
